RULE ANALYSIS

Purpose of the rule or reason for the change:

Off-Highway Vehicle (OHV) registration fees have remained constant for many years. The Division, in an effort to operate as a business identified that the snowmobile grooming program was exceeding expenses, compared to revenue collected. In 2012, there was legislation introduced (S.B. 15) that would allow the Board of Parks and Recreation to increase the annual snowmobile registration fee to a maximum of $26. In addition, the annual registration fee for each ATV and OHM would increase to $18, with $1 being provided to the Utah Highway Patrol Aero Bureau restricted account.

Summary of the rule or change:

OHV registration fees are currently set at $17 per registration. In addition to the registration fee, several additional fees are charged, including a $2 education fee, a $2 DMV electronic payment fee, a 50 cent search and rescue fee, $1.50 towards School and Trust Lands Administration and a $1 transaction fee bringing the total fee to $17. OHV owners must also pay a property tax assessment to their county of residence prior to registering an OHV. During calendar year 2011, 199,070 off-highway vehicles were registered in Utah. These registrations produced a net revenue to the Division of approximately $3,300,000. Beginning 07/01/2012, the Utah Highway Patrol Aero Bureau will receive $1 automatically from each OHV registration, potentially costing the Division $199,070 per year at the current registration rates. The only way for the Division to recoup this lost revenue is through a registration fee increase for each ATV and OHM. Simultaneously, by increasing the snowmobile registration fee, as identified with the passing and signing of S.B. 15 (2012 General Session), this will increase revenue by approximately $104,000. This additional revenue will be used exclusively for the snowmobile grooming operations.

Anticipated cost or savings to:

the state budget:

In order to offset the $104,000 cut to the OHV Off-Highway Restricted Fund budget, a $1 fee increase is proposed for each registered Off Highway Vehicle. The snowmobile registration fees will increase to $4 to cover operational costs of the snowmobile grooming program.

local governments:

There are no additional costs or savings to local government. This affects state government and users only.

small businesses:

This could affect small businesses associated with registration of Off-Highway Vehicles. On each ATV and snowmobile registration, the fees will increase $1 to cover the costs associated with the Utah Highway Patrol Aero Bureau Division. On snowmobiles, the registration fees will increase $4 to cover operational costs of the snowmobile grooming program.

RULE TEXT

R651. Natural Resources, Parks and Recreation.

R651-406. Off-Highway Vehicle Registration Fees.

R651-406-1. Annual Registration Fee.

The annual All-terrain Vehicle and off-highway motorcycle registration fee is $[17]18. The annual snowmobile registration fee is $22.

 

R651-406-2. Fee For Duplicate Registration.

The fee for a duplicate certificate of registration is $3.

 

R651-406-3. Fee For Duplicate Numbered Stickers.

The fee for duplicate numbered stickers is $5.
